Abstract
The utility model discloses a cable protection tube capable of quickly dissipating heat, which comprises a protection tube body made of plastics, wherein the protection tube body comprises an inner tube and an outer tube, the outer tube is of a hollow structure, the section of the hollow structure is trapezoidal, the inner tube is arranged in the hollow structure, a channel for dissipating heat is formed between the inner tube and the outer tube, reinforcing ribs are arranged between the inner tube and the outer tube, the number of the reinforcing ribs is four, and the four reinforcing ribs are respectively positioned at four corners of the trapezoidal hollow structure.

Background
With the transformation of urban power grids and the advancement of communication services, cable protection pipes are widely applied to prevent cable damage. The conventional cable protection pipe includes a steel pipe, a cement pipe and a plastic pipe. Steel pipe and cement pipe because self weight is heavier, and the installation is inconvenient, when the overhead line of cable, heavy burden increases, endangers support or bridge safety, and plastic tubing radiating efficiency is not high, and the cable can produce a large amount of heats after the circular telegram, and the intraductal effluvium of cable protection is followed fast to a large amount of heats, arouses the high temperature conflagration easily.

As shown in fig. 1 to 2, a cable protection tube with rapid heat dissipation comprises a protection tube body made of plastic, wherein the protection tube body comprises an inner tube 4 and an outer tube 1, the outer tube 1 is a hollow structure 2, the cross section of the hollow structure 2 is trapezoidal, the inner tube 4 is arranged in the hollow structure 2, a channel for heat dissipation is formed between the inner tube 4 and the outer tube 1, reinforcing ribs 3 are arranged between the inner tube 4 and the outer tube 1, the number of the reinforcing ribs 3 is four, the four reinforcing ribs 3 are respectively positioned at four corners of the trapezoidal hollow structure 2, a heat dissipation device is arranged in the channel, the heat dissipation device comprises a water inlet tube and a water outlet tube, the water inlet tube is communicated with the water outlet tube, the water inlet tube is connected with a water pump, the water pump is connected with a water tank, the water tank is connected with the water outlet tube, the heat dissipation device comprises a fan, a connecting portion 5 is convexly arranged at one end of the inner tube 4, the connecting part 5 is provided with an external thread, and the inner side of the other end of the inner tube 4 is provided with an internal thread corresponding to the external thread.
The working principle of the utility model is that the section of the hollow structure 2 is trapezoidal, which ensures the compressive strength of the protection tube body, the reinforcing ribs 3, the inner tube 4 and the outer tube 1 form a structure similar to triangle, which further improves the compressive strength of the protection tube body, the air in the channel accelerates the heat dissipation efficiency of the inner tube 4, the water inlet pipe and the water outlet pipe are additionally arranged in the channel further accelerates the heat dissipation of the inner tube 4, the water pump and the water tank can be arranged outside the protection tube body, the air circulation in the channel is accelerated by arranging the fan in the channel, the heat dissipation of the inner tube 4 is further accelerated, when the protection tube is installed, a plurality of protection tubes need to be connected together end to end, the adjacent protection tube bodies can be connected and installed by the connecting part 5, which facilitates the assembly of the protection tube and improves the installation efficiency.
